package org.apache.tools.ant.types.resources;
import java.io.File;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.InputStream;
import java.io.OutputStream;
import java.io.FileInputStream;
import java.io.FileOutputStream;
import org.apache.tools.ant.Project;
import org.apache.tools.ant.BuildException;
import org.apache.tools.ant.util.FileUtils;
import org.apache.tools.ant.types.Resource;
import org.apache.tools.ant.types.Reference;
import org.apache.tools.ant.types.ResourceFactory;
/**
* A Resource representation of a File.
* @since Ant 1.7
*/
public class FileResource extends Resource implements Touchable, FileProvider,
ResourceFactory {
private static final FileUtils FILE_UTILS = FileUtils.getFileUtils();
private static final int NULL_FILE
= Resource.getMagicNumber("null file".getBytes());
private File file;
private File baseDir;
/**
* Default constructor.
*/
public FileResource() {
}
/**
* Construct a new FileResource using the specified basedir and relative name.
* @param b the basedir as File.
* @param name the relative filename.
*/
public FileResource(File b, String name) {
setFile(FILE_UTILS.resolveFile(b, name));
setBaseDir(b);
}
/**
* Construct a new FileResource from a File.
* @param f the File represented.
*/
public FileResource(File f) {
setFile(f);
}
/**
* Constructor for Ant attribute introspection.
* @param p the Project against which to resolve <code>s</code>.
* @param s the absolute or Project-relative filename as a String.
* @see org.apache.tools.ant.IntrospectionHelper
*/
public FileResource(Project p, String s) {
this(p.resolveFile(s));
setProject(p);
}
/**
* Set the File for this FileResource.
* @param f the File to be represented.
*/
public void setFile(File f) {
checkAttributesAllowed();
file = f;
}
/**
* Get the file represented by this FileResource.
* @return the File.
*/
public File getFile() {
return isReference() ? ((FileResource) getCheckedRef()).getFile() : file;
}
/**
* Set the basedir for this FileResource.
* @param b the basedir as File.
*/
public void setBaseDir(File b) {
checkAttributesAllowed();
baseDir = b;
}
/**
* Return the basedir to which the name is relative.
* @return the basedir as File.
*/
public File getBaseDir() {
return isReference()
? ((FileResource) getCheckedRef()).getBaseDir() : baseDir;
}
/**
* Overrides the super version.
* @param r the Reference to set.
*/
public void setRefid(Reference r) {
if (file != null || baseDir != null) {
throw tooManyAttributes();
}
super.setRefid(r);
}
/**
* Get the name of this FileResource. If the basedir is set,
* the name will be relative to that. Otherwise the basename
* only will be returned.
* @return the name of this resource.
*/
public String getName() {
if (isReference()) {
return 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).getName();
}
File b = getBaseDir();
return b == null ? getNotNullFile().getName()
: FILE_UTILS.removeLeadingPath(b, getNotNullFile());
}
/**
* Learn whether this file exists.
* @return true if this resource exists.
*/
public boolean isExists() {
return isReference() ? 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).isExists()
: getNotNullFile().exists();
}
/**
* Get the modification time in milliseconds since 01.01.1970 .
* @return 0 if the resource does not exist.
*/
public long getLastModified() {
return isReference()
? 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).getLastModified()
: getNotNullFile().lastModified();
}
/**
* Learn whether the resource is a directory.
* @return boolean flag indicating if the resource is a directory.
*/
public boolean isDirectory() {
return isReference() ? 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).isDirectory()
: getNotNullFile().isDirectory();
}
/**
* Get the size of this Resource.
* @return the size, as a long, 0 if the Resource does not exist.
*/
public long getSize() {
return isReference() ? 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).getSize()
: getNotNullFile().length();
}
/**
* Return an InputStream for reading the contents of this Resource.
* @return an InputStream object.
* @throws IOException if an error occurs.
*/
public InputStream getInputStream() throws IOException {
return isReference()
? 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).getInputStream()
: new FileInputStream(getNotNullFile());
}
/**
* Get an OutputStream for the Resource.
* @return an OutputStream to which content can be written.
* @throws IOException if unable to provide the content of this
* Resource as a stream.
* @throws UnsupportedOperationException if OutputStreams are not
* supported for this Resource type.
*/
public OutputStream getOutputStream() throws IOException {
if (isReference()) {
return ((Resource) getCheckedRef()).getOutputStream();
}
File f = getNotNullFile();
if (f.exists()) {
if (f.isFile()) {
f.delete();
}
} else {
File p = f.getParentFile();
if (p != null && !(p.exists())) {
p.mkdirs();
}
}
return new FileOutputStream(f);
}
/**
* Compare this FileResource to another Resource.
* @param another the other Resource against which to compare.
* @return a negative integer, zero, or a positive integer as this FileResource
* is less than, equal to, or greater than the specified Resource.
*/
public int compareTo(Object another) {
if (isReference()) {
return ((Comparable) getCheckedRef()).compareTo(another);
}
if (this.equals(another)) {
return 0;
}
if (another.getClass().equals(getClass())) {
FileResource otherfr = (FileResource) another;
File f = getFile();
if (f == null) {
return -1;
}
File of = otherfr.getFile();
if (of == null) {
return 1;
}
return f.compareTo(of);
}
return super.compareTo(another);
}
/**
* Compare another Object to this FileResource for equality.
* @param another the other Object to compare.
* @return true if another is a FileResource representing the same file.
*/
public boolean equals(Object another) {
if (this == another) {
return true;
}
if (isReference()) {
return getCheckedRef().equals(another);
}
if (!(another.getClass().equals(getClass()))) {
return false;
}
FileResource otherfr = (FileResource) another;
return getFile() == null
? otherfr.getFile() == null
: getFile().equals(otherfr.getFile());
}
/**
* Get the hash code for this Resource.
* @return hash code as int.
*/
public int hashCode() {
if (isReference()) {
return getCheckedRef().hashCode();
}
return MAGIC * (getFile() == null ? NULL_FILE : getFile().hashCode());
}
/**
* Get the string representation of this Resource.
* @return this FileResource formatted as a String.
*/
public String toString() {
if (isReference()) {
return getCheckedRef().toString();
}
if (file == null) {
return "(unbound file resource)";
}
String absolutePath = file.getAbsolutePath();
return FILE_UTILS.normalize(absolutePath).getAbsolutePath();
}
/**
* Fulfill the ResourceCollection contract.
* @return whether this Resource is a FileResource.
*/
public boolean isFilesystemOnly() {
return !isReference()
|| ((FileResource) getCheckedRef()).isFilesystemOnly();
}
/**
* Implement the Touchable interface.
* @param modTime new last modification time.
*/
public void touch(long modTime) {
if (isReference()) {
((FileResource) getCheckedRef()).touch(modTime);
return;
}
getNotNullFile().setLastModified(modTime);
}
/**
* Get the file represented by this FileResource, ensuring it is not null.
* @return the not-null File.
* @throws BuildException if file is null.
*/
protected File getNotNullFile() {
if (getFile() == null) {
throw new BuildException("file attribute is null!");
}
return getFile();
}
/**
* Create a new resource that matches a relative or absolute path.
* If the current instance has a baseDir attribute, it is copied.
* @param path relative/absolute path to a resource
* @return a new resource of type FileResource
* @throws BuildException if desired
* @since Ant1.8
*/
public Resource getResource(String path) {
File newfile = FILE_UTILS.resolveFile(getFile(), path);
FileResource fileResource = new FileResource(newfile);
fileResource.setBaseDir(getBaseDir());
return fileResource;
}
}
